Reviewed September 19, 2022

Came here on a Saturday, and we were lucky to get a seat. This is a very busy place. I would highly recommend reservations. We started with the Table/Garlic bread and it came out piping hot and was fluffy and tasty. They have a wood...burning oven, so we ordered some pizza's. We opted to build our own, and when they came out they were perfect, thin crust and not over done or loaded. The slices had a great cheese pull while eating. The flavor was excellent and we enjoyed the pizza's, We shared the Sticky Toffee pudding, it was good, but I will say I have had better. The menu however is more than just pizza. We saw so many other dishes that came out that looked fabulous. Which only means I need to go back several times to work my way thru the menu.More

Reviewed October 20, 2019

I ordered Shrimp on the Rocks with a side order of mixed vegetables. A very small sizzling rock is delivered with the raw shrimp, the shrimp barely fit on it. By the time hte shrimp were cooked, (I had to do them in batches as...they kept falling off), the rock wasn't very hot, and my vegetables also kept falling off as it was so small. I assumed I would only be cooking the shrimp and would not have ordered the side of vegetables had I known I had to cook them too. When I mentioned that to the waitress she flippantly answered "That's what you get at Hot Rocks". My friend and I both found the waitress who served us a bit rude and didn't really care about our meal or service. My friend ordered the Compressed Watermelon Salad, with a sides of shrimp and salmon and dessert, Creme Brulee, served in the tiniest ramekin dish I've ever seen. She did not have a drink, not even coffee. Her salad (including the two pricey sides) barely filled a medium sized plate (how big was it without the sides??). Her meal was $40. Mine, of which I only ate the shrimp, the vegetables were too high maintenance and the rock wasn't hot any more. When our waitress took my plate away, she made no comment on how I hadn't eaten the vegetables. (again, didn't care). We both felt the service was poor, the quality of what we paid for and received extremely over priced. there is a lot of dining competition in Whitby, my friend and I try a new restaurant every week. We will not return to Hot Rocks.More

Reviewed October 17, 2019 via mobile

We frequent this lovely establishment about two or three times a year, usually for their delicious pizza but decided on something different this time. I had the snapper which was a special they had on and my husband had the bacon burger. My fish was...very good and came with a good sized portion of asparagus, tangy relish and rice. My husband's burger was outstanding! I wished I had ordered that after I had a bite. They grind their own brisket and grind the bacon right into the mixture. It was so darn delicious I want to go back soon just for that. The burger came with really fresh, extremely hot fries which were also tasty. The place was very busy for a Wednesday night so reservations would be a good idea. We were amazed at all the families with babies that were there. It's so nice seeing that babies can be accommodated in a nice bistro type restaurant. I seem to remember having to eat at boring big box chain restaurants when our children were little. Yet, if you want a cozy dinner for two this place is perfect too. We didn't have room for dessert but we know that they make their own fresh desserts daily, particularly cheesecake, which changes every day.More
